Chicken Paprikash

Chicken paprikash in skillet.
Chicken Paprikash. Photo credit: Primal Edge Health.

Chicken Paprikash wraps classic chicken dinner in warm Hungarian flavors. Chicken simmers gently in a paprika-laced sauce until tender, then gets finished with cream for a silky, spoon-coating gravy. Serve over egg noodles or rice for a bowl that feels like it’s been in the family for generations.
